Since 2016, I’ve worked as an Assistant Professor in the Department of Theater at Swarthmore College.
For the department, I’ve taught a number of classes that explore directing, devising, and acting, and directed several productions. My work with students addresses two major concerns:
Learning to create your own theater work through an exploration/identification/celebration of one’s own authentic values and concerns; and
Performance as a tool of empowerment, using the practice of embodied experiences to build capacity for vulnerability, risk-taking, and collaboration.
